مستحب

Arabic

Etymology

Derived from the passive participle of اِسْتَحَبَّ (istaḥabba, to deem something recommendable), form X of ح ب ب (ḥ-b-b).

Adjective

مُسْتَحَبّ (mustaḥabb)

  1. (that which is deemed) recommendable
  2. (Islamic law) mustahabb, an action that is recommended, but not mandatory
